]> git.0d.be Git - empathy.git/commitdiff
Enable audio/video capabilities if InitialAudio/Video is in the fixed props for Strea...
authorYouness Alaoui <youness.alaoui@collabora.co.uk>
Tue, 5 Apr 2011 01:41:40 +0000 (21:41 -0400)
committerDanielle Madeley <danielle.madeley@collabora.co.uk>
Wed, 13 Apr 2011 00:29:08 +0000 (10:29 +1000)
libempathy/empathy-contact.c

index bf0da384c0d06780387308c235c7bf6b52237f0c..680094a547d19e3869c17d934601b1b1b5eaa6e0 100644 (file)
@@ -1721,6 +1721,13 @@ tp_caps_to_capabilities (TpCapabilities *caps)
                     TP_PROP_CHANNEL_TYPE_STREAMED_MEDIA_INITIAL_VIDEO))
                 capabilities |= EMPATHY_CAPABILITIES_VIDEO;
             }
+
+          if (tp_asv_get_boolean (fixed_prop,
+                    TP_PROP_CHANNEL_TYPE_STREAMED_MEDIA_INITIAL_AUDIO, NULL))
+            capabilities |= EMPATHY_CAPABILITIES_AUDIO;
+          if (tp_asv_get_boolean (fixed_prop,
+                    TP_PROP_CHANNEL_TYPE_STREAMED_MEDIA_INITIAL_VIDEO, NULL))
+            capabilities |= EMPATHY_CAPABILITIES_VIDEO;
         }
     }